As this was our first trip to New York, I'd say we picked a hotel with one of the best locations for New York first-timers! It's in the middle of Downtown New York, a large part of which is the Financial District. It seems like a very safe location to be, with the New York Stock Exchange, the 9/11 memorial, Trinity Church, and many other well-known NYC sites just around the corner. The hotel is located just across the street from the East River, almost on the shore, where amazing views of Brooklyn and the Brooklyn Bridge will remind you of all the movies you've ever seen set in New York. There are many nice bars around, as well as one of the most important subway stations (Fulton Street) that will take you anywhere you want to go within or outside of Manhattan. With the Brooklyn Bridge, Wall Street, and the start of Broadway just 3-5 minutes away on foot, we'd usually start our days walking towards Uptown, and then when we get tired, descend into the underground and catch a subway train to where we want to go. Keep walking North of the hotel, and you'll get to incredibly interesting, less posh neighborhoods, such as Chinatown, Korea Town, Little Italy, and Ukrainian Village, all with their own unique flavors, but still undeniably a part of Manhattan and New York - must see! The hotel itself looks rather old but very well preserved, as, to my surprise, most of Manhattan and its buildings. The staff is mostly very pleasant, friendly and helpful, especially Joel, who works at reception. Although we were initially supposed to be on one of the lower levels, we got an upgrade to our room from the kind staff, as they had some vacancies, and we got an amazing room on the 36th floor with an incredible view of the Financial District, giving the whole trip a whole new dimension! We spent most of our non-sleep time in the room staring out the windows. The room was tidy, and cleaned daily, the toilette was decent.
